Reflex Gaming launches Get Kraken slot, built on Yggdrasil technology

Reflex Gaming has launched Get Kraken, a new undersea-themed slot game powered by Yggdrasil.

The title is built around a Kraken Wild in a dedicated position on the centre reel, which collects Coins and Gems when it lands. Four coloured Gem symbols unlock the MINI, MINOR, MAJOR and GRAND pot prizes, while three Special Kraken features—BOOST, MULTIPLY and RESPIN—are positioned as progressive unlocks.

Two Treasure Chests above the reels build when the Kraken lands and can open randomly to award Free Spins regardless of size. Standard Treasure Chests award six Free Spins, while Golden Chests award 12. During Free Spins, the triggering Kraken remains locked in place, and opened chests can reset, reopen and persist back into the base game.

Special Krakens are unlocked by landing Kraken symbols, with progress tracked via an on-screen counter that persists between sessions. BOOST unlocks after five Kraken symbols, MULTI after a further 10, and RESPIN after another 15, and can then appear in both base play and Free Spins. The game also includes a Kraken Character Modifier that can trigger at the start or end of a spin to guarantee or nudge a Kraken landing.

In supporting jurisdictions, Reflex said Golden Bet and Bonus Buy are available. Golden Bet is positioned to increase the chances of Kraken landings, collections and Free Spins, while Bonus Buy offers three routes into Free Spins at varying stake multiples.
